How To Carpet Removal?

Clear the room of all furniture and items

Remove doors if needed for easier access

Put on gloves, safety glasses, and a dust mask

Locate the carpet edge at a corner or doorway

Use pliers to grip and lift the carpet edge

Cut the carpet into manageable strips with a utility knife

Roll up each strip as you remove it

Remove carpet tack strips carefully with a pry bar

Pull up the carpet padding and staple strips

Scrape any leftover adhesive or padding residue from the floor

Remove staples, nails, and debris from the subfloor

Dispose of carpet, padding, and tack strips properly

Vacuum the floor thoroughly after removal
